Gross Margin is the amount of money a company retains after incurring the direct costs associated with producing the goods it sells and the services it provides. The higher the gross margin, the more capital a company retains, which it can then use to pay other costs or satisfy debt obligations.

Shanghai Electric Group Co., Ltd., a formidable powerhouse in the global market, is renowned for its prowess in manufacturing and delivering top-tier equipment for the power generation, industrial, and integration systems sectors. Established in the bustling metropolis of Shanghai, the company has become synonymous with innovation and engineering excellence, seamlessly blending tradition with cutting-edge technology. At its core, Shanghai Electric operates through several sectors, including energy equipment, industrial equipment, and integrated services, each playing a pivotal role in the energy and power infrastructure that fuels economies around the world. This vast empire functions like a well-oiled machine, utilizing its expertise to develop high-efficiency power plants, automation solutions, and environmental protection systems. Shanghai Electric makes money by crafting the vital components and systems that keep industries running efficiently and sustainably. The company's diverse portfolio extends beyond the obvious, as it invests heavily in renewable energy solutions like wind and solar power, tapping into a growing global demand for cleaner, more sustainable energy sources. It sells its cutting-edge technology and equipment to various sectors—ranging from electric power, marine, and nuclear to environmental and transportation industries—thereby ensuring a steady revenue stream. At the same time, it provides integrated services, from construction and maintenance to software solutions, offering a comprehensive suite that enhances its value proposition and competitive edge. In essence, Shanghai Electric Group is not just a manufacturer; it is a vital cog in the global industrial landscape, pushing the boundaries of sustainable energy production and industrial modernization.

What is the Gross Margin of Shanghai Electric Group Co Ltd?

Based on Shanghai Electric Group Co Ltd's most recent financial statements, the company has Gross Margin of 17.6%.
